Describes how a group of nurse managers developed a tool for measuring the quality of care in mental hospital wards and how this was adapted for use within general elderly services. Examines the impact of the tool on service provision within a group of small local community hospitals and evaluates it using a matrix composed of Donabedian’s structure/process/outcome model of quality and Maxwell’s six dimensions of quality.
